Private Real Estate Mortgages in Poughkeepsie
Private real estate financing helps investors purchase, renovate or refinance a property utilizing a short-term mortgage from a private company or an individual. As opposed to bank loans, Poughkeepsie private mortgage loans are fast closing, easy qualifying and open to self-employed applicants.
It means that regardless of whether you have a good credit score, you've still got a good chance of obtaining private money for a real estate loan so long as your investment is presumed to be profitable, you have enough capital to put towards the downpayment, you have demonstrated yourself competent in real estate previously, you have substantial equity in the property or home or you have an intelligible plan to take care of the loan. Combined with fast closings of just fourteen days, private real estate mortgages in Poughkeepsie may very well be the right choice for ambitious real estate investors.
Often, borrowers pay a visit to Poughkeepsie private mortgage lenders to loan money for their real estate activities when:
-
A remodeling job or update can help to market their property at a higher price point or ask for more rent.
E.g. a past client owned a twin-home / duplex. At the time, he had a significant amount of equity in the property and the monthly rent generated steady revenue. A few choice home upgrades would undoubtedly help him increase his rental prices, but since he had a low credit score of 520, it was extremely certain that a bank would turn down the loan request. After he got into contact with Read Rock Capital to get financing, we were glad to do a cash-out refinance for 65% of the duplex's assessed value.

They have numerous debts and prefer to combine them.
The majority of people find that it's stressful to deal with countless payments each month. To successfully make the situation more manageable, people combine all their unsecured debts into an individual loan with only one payment per month.

They prefer to allocate their existing equity in one property and use it to acquire another one.
To provide an example, a client in Hawaii owned a home appraised at $1.2M. Because it was challenging for him to find a buyer for his house, he had somebody who was open to lease it with an option to buy. The income that stemmed from the lease contract took care of his regular mortgage bill, home owner's insurance, and property taxes. The renter also went ahead and paid him 200k in the form of a deposit for the three year lease. Having these assurances to take care of the house's foreseeable expenses, he stumbled on another promising real estate investment opportunity and approached Read Rock Capital to obtain a private mortgage loan nearly 70% of the property's valuation. This gave him plenty of money to put towards a deposit or his next investment, but additionally helped him pay off the existing mortgage.

The balloon payment for an existing loan is due and they are not able to handle it.
If an unforeseen incident stops someone from making his balloon payment due date, he can contact an alternative mortgage lender to refinance. Refinancing before the due date allows the borrower to meet the due date for the balloon payment and stay clear of fines in connection with failing to pay the balloon payment.
